I find that there is a lot you can gain from talking with less attractive girls also.

Earlier, when I was trying to develop my skillset fast, I ran into issues because I would chode off all night, and then when I saw a girl that I actually wanted to approach, I'd be all in my head and it would never go well.

What I do now, and what seems to work best for my students is to start getting social RIGHT AWAY>

Get into that social head space and build momentum, so when you see that hottie later in the night, you'll already be in a good mood to go approach her.

The other benefit is that if your only goal when approaching early in the night is to get social, you have no outcome. And since you don't care what happens in the interaction, you shouldn't have much anxiety.

Who cares if you get blown out, you were just trying to be social anyways...
